Tech Talk Without the Boredom Factor
Let’s decode the jargon soup:
- V2G (Vehicle-to-Grid): Your future EV might moonlight as a power bank for the neighborhood
- BESS: Battery Energy Storage Systems – the beating heart of MESS
- Second-life batteries: Retired EV batteries finding new purpose in storage units (like golf clubs for retired athletes)
